The name of the Magnificat prayer comes from the first words of Mary's song in Luke 1:46-55: "Magnificat anima mea Dominum" (My soul magnifies the Lord, or, My soul proclaims the greatness of the Lord).
In the Roman Catholic Liturgy of the Hours, the prayer is recited during the Vespers (Evening Prayer). The Magnificat is a canticle, a Christian song of praise that in this case is taken directly from the words of the Blessed Virgin Mary in Scripture.
Mary recites the prayer during the Visitation with her cousin Elizabeth, who greets her with the familiar words, "Blessed are you among women, and blessed is the fruit of your womb" (Lk 1:42).
What is the message of the Magnificat?
Echoing the words of the Blessed Virgin Mary, we might meditate on the the the following thoughts:
1. How will we magnify the Lord's presence in our lives? How will we proclaim the greatness of the Lord?
2. What tempts us to be proud, mighty, or stronger than others?
3. How can we serve others on behalf of God?
The Magnificat Prayer
My soul proclaims the greatness of the Lord,
my spirit rejoices in God my Savior
for he has looked with favor on his lowly servant.
From this day all generations will call me blessed:
the Almighty has done great things for me,
and holy is his Name.
He has mercy on those who fear him
in every generation.
He has shown the strength of his arm,
he has scattered the proud in their conceit.
He has cast down the mighty from their thrones,
and has lifted up the lowly.
He has filled the hungry with good things,
and the rich he has sent away empty.
He has come to the help of his servant Israel
for he remembered his promise of mercy,
the promise he made to our fathers,
to Abraham and his children forever.
(Lk 1:46-55)

The key (or source) to the Magnificat is in found in 1 Samuel 2 and the prayer of Hannah. Hannah's story is one of deliverance from her fear of barrenness (hopelessness) through faith in the Lord's anointed (1 Samuel 2:10) (God's salvation). This is fulfilled in Christ as the true and pure David and it is why Mary's prayer is basically the same (thematically) as Hannah's if you read them side by side. The Magnificat is the bookend to Hannah's prophetic prayer. I had to study 1 Samuel 2 this week so I found this pretty interesting.
